Has anyone ever researched putting a transmission cooler on this car? Is it possible? If so, what company makes them? I think TOZO might be the man to ask on this if you're out there.

marklar182
March 22nd, 2011, 01:08
The car has a (not very adequate IMO) trans cooler system. The fluid passes through the radiator then to a small oil/trans cooler.

Sportec made separate Oil/Gearbox oil coolers for their intercooler kits. These sat behind the intercoolers and aux radiators. I believe they used 25row Setrab coolers on each side. (I am looking to this route down the road)

FMU is developing a large front mount oil/trans cooler combo, but blocking the rad/condenser further is asking for trouble IMO.

I still may consider the FMU oil cooler with my set up. The unit sits low, underneath the sub bumper. There are not many options. I actually have a derale trans cooler mounted on my 71 bronco(swapped to an auto), rated for 28k lbs gvw. It has a temp sensor fan, easy to wire an plumb, wish I had room because the unit is actually pretty small and helps out big time( I have a temp gauge on the dash to monitor. Off roading heats the heck out of a tranny.
